Presentation is loading. Please wait.

Presentation is loading. Please wait.

Student: Ibraheem Frieslaar Supervisor: Mehrdad Ghaziasgar.

Similar presentations


Presentation on theme: "Student: Ibraheem Frieslaar Supervisor: Mehrdad Ghaziasgar."— Presentation transcript:

1 Student: Ibraheem Frieslaar Supervisor: Mehrdad Ghaziasgar

2 OVERVIEW INTRODUCTION USER REQUIREMENTS USER INTERFACE SPECIFICATION HIGH LEVEL DESIGN IMPLEMENTATION TESTING THE SYSTEM DEMO REFERENCES QUESTIONS & ANSWERS

3 INTRODUCTION Eye ball tracker Using the webcam to determine eye gaze location Moving the mouse to that location

4 USER REQUIREMENTS High Accuracy Correct Point Immediately

5 USER INTERFACE SPECIFICATION  Runs in the Background  It’s a Daemon

6 High Level Design Input Webcam Input Webcam Move Mouse Pointer Image Processing Image Processing

7 Implementation Move Mouse Last Pixel Dynamic Threshold Face Detect HSV

8 Testing the System The subject sat with his face in the centre of the screen The subject looked at each point on the screen in a systematic order, from point 1 till 12. Each time the subject looked to a different point, the time the mouse took to move to the specific point was recorded. This test was carried out 10 times on each subject

9 Testing the System

10 Testing Results

11 Accuracy:

12 Tools Used Windows 7 Visual Studi 2010 Opencv 2.1

13 Demo

14 REFERENCES OpenCVWiki. [Online]. http://opencv.willowgarage.com/wiki/FullOpenCVWiki http://opencv.willowgarage.com/wiki/FullOpenCVWiki Heiko Drewes, "Eye Gaze Tracking for Human Computer Interaction," Ludwig-Maximilians-Universität, Munich, 2010.

15


Download ppt "Student: Ibraheem Frieslaar Supervisor: Mehrdad Ghaziasgar."

Similar presentations


Ads by Google